Master Theses winter semester 2023/2024


 

Dates for writing a master thesis at our professorship in winter semester 2023/2024:

 

  • Announcement of the list of topics: Mon., 9 October 2023
  • Deadline for naming your topic preferences or submitting the exposé: Sun., 15 October 2023
  • Kick-off event:   Wed., 18 October 2023, 09:00 (s.t.) (via BBB)
  • 1st colloquium: Wed., 22 November 2023, 09:00 (s.t.) (via BBB)
  • 2nd colloquium: Wed., 20 December 2023, 09:00 (s.t.) (via BBB)
  • 3rd colloquium:  Wed., 7 February 2024, 09:00 (s.t.) (via BBB)
  • Submission: Mon., 9 April 2024 (4-semester Master), Thu., 15 February 2024 (2-semester Master)

 

Participation in the kick-off event is mandatory, whereas participation in the colloquia is optional, but strongly recommended.

 

Since the summer semester 2017, Master theses can also be written in German at the Professor BWL VI. However, in view of the English language literature, we recommend writing the Master thesis in English.

 

We would be pleased to receive your own topic suggestions from your side. You are welcome to be inspired by the titles listed below or to choose them as your topic (you are welcome to make changes to the titles).

Possible theses topics:


  • CSR and corporate value creation 
  • Sustainability factors in remuneration policies of DAX and MDAX companies
  • Say on Climate: shareholder activism in the area of sustainability 
  • ESG Ratings: chances and limitations 
  • The financial performance of green bonds 
  • The effects of non-financial disclosures on financial performance
  • Compliance of the Declarations of Conformity of DAX companies with the German Corporate Governance Kodex (Übereinstimmung mit dem Deutschen Corporate Governance Kodex anhand der Entsprechenserklärung) 
  • Cultural differences in the CEOs' letters to shareholders and their stock price effects
  • Cultural effects on corporate financial decisions
  • Gender differences in financial risk-taking
